Recognized as a leader in the field of linguistics and health communication, Peter Joseph Torres serves as an Assistant Professor in the English and Linguistics and Applied Linguistics departments at Arizona State University-West. His academic journey is marked by a profound commitment to understanding the complexities of discourse analysis, particularly as they relate to pressing health issues. Torres's research is distinguished by its innovative integration of qualitative and quantitative methodologies, allowing for a nuanced examination of both written and spoken discourses. His work primarily focuses on the opioid crisis, a critical area of study given its widespread impact on public health. By exploring the influence of sociocultural factors on pain portrayal and prescribing practices, Torres aims to shed light on how language shapes and is shaped by health communication. His scholarly contributions have been recognized in esteemed journals such as Discourse Studies, Applied Corpus Linguistics, and the Journal of Pragmatics, reflecting his dedication to advancing knowledge in his field. Torres's academic credentials are equally impressive. He earned his Ph.D. in Linguistics from the University of California, Davis, where he also completed his M.A. in Linguistics. His foundational studies in Linguistics and Anthropology were undertaken at the University of California, Los Angeles, providing him with a broad and interdisciplinary perspective that informs his current research endeavors.
